第一章介绍了操作系统的基本概念,包括其作为软件的第一层,为其他应用提供运行环境,以及在硬件和用户程序间的作用。操作系统的关键功能包括处理机管理、内存管理、设备管理、文件管理等,支持多任务、并发、共享和虚拟等特性。发展历史上,操作系统经历了批处理系统、分时系统、实时系统等阶段,并随着技术进步出现了多种类型,如网络、实时和嵌入式系统。此外,还讨论了操作系统的体系结构,如单体内核、层次结构和微内核技术,以及指令执行的基本过程。